You will given the opportunity to: *Direct, coordinate all shift production and maintenance team members activities relating to their assigned area. To cover all plant activities. *Ensure all production standards for throughput, downtime, and yield are at or above budgeted levels. *Ensure Safety and OSHA regulations are enforced, and that Visual Workplace , T.P.M. standards are at the highest level. *Develop, plan and implement organizational and operational changes to facilitate scheduling needs. *Ensure product quality meets internal and customer specifications. *Develop and improve the skill base of team members, both as individuals and as a team. *Demonstrate a total commitment in leading the team to achieve World-Class standards by applying and improving best known practices. *Ensure employees are provided appropriate guidance, counseling, or recognition on matters related to job performance. Provide consistent guidance within plant policies and procedures with team members on performance and absenteeism issues following the plant’s corrective action process.
